The aim of our research team is to advance the understanding of the electrocatalytic reactions and material degradation processes in electrochemical energy conversion technologies.
Our goal is to use this knowledge to design and develop novel advanced functional materials. In this, we rely on unique coupled techniques and high-throughput methods developed in the group.
Our research interests span a wide range of problems at the interface of fundamental electrochemistry and electrochemical engineering. Current research topics include fuel cells, water electrolysis, photo-electrochemistry, and noble metals recycling.
